“``The home is a ministry field. How is the home a ministry field? It shows your children how to forgive. The home is is a ministry field when you teach your children that you serve without necessarily needing applause. The home is a ministry field when your children see you honoring their mother. The home is a ministry field when we admit our wrongs and ask for forgiveness. The home is a ministry field when we place God in every decision we make.”

“Fathers are not gifts because they are flawless. So God is not necessarily calling us as part fathers to be perfect, but to give direction. Let me draw an analogy with this. A compass. We all know what a compass is. Right? A compass does not move anybody's a compass does what? Points to the direct direction that you must go. Fathers, mentors, grandfathers, let's be compass to our children. Let's be compass to those that God has placed around us. Help them in their work. Amen?”

“Fathers build up, not tear down. Fathers build up, not tear down. Another word for edification, build. So how do we build? We build with our mouths. Bible says that death and life, the power of the tongue. What words are your children hearing from you? Godly leadership strengthens, does not crush. Let me say that again. Godly leadership strengthens, does not crush. So when you when you when you build your children, you are empowering them. When you speak words of affirmation to them, they are positive words, words that allows them to grow. Amen?”

“Please, let's dispel this notion that ministry is at the pulpit or begins at the pulpit. It does not. Ministry begins in everyday obedience at home, at school, at work, in relationships. Whatever Christ is forming in you on a daily basis is your ministry because a lot of times, we are the epistle that others are reading. Pastor says that quite a bit here.”
